About The Role
Our team creates unforgettable live experiences enjoyed by audiences around the world. We are looking for a Touring Production Manager to join us from late April through May, and then again from late July through September, leading the on-the-ground execution of an outdoor Concert and Drone show across multiple European cities.
This role is integral to delivering a consistent, safe, and exceptional show every time we open our gates. The Touring Production Manager will own the onsite execution of each event location, from load-in, to operations, to load-out, ensuring that every detail aligns with our quality standards and guest experience expectations.
What You’ll Do
Advance & Pre-Production
- Work with our Lead Producer who will hand off the advance with venues, production vendors, local authorities, and internal teams.
- Consult with internal stakeholders providing feedback on technical and operational needs to ensure seamless execution.
- Review technical drawings, site plans, and venue specs to confirm feasibility and optimize execution.
- Build detailed production schedules covering load-in, tech, rehearsals, show operations, and load-out.
- Plan staffing, trailer movement, and logistics tailored to each market.
- Work with drones team to align with their tech departments
Onsite Production Leadership
- Serve as the primary production lead onsite, overseeing local vendors and operational components during load-in, rehearsals, show runs and load out.
- Supervise local crew, and FOH teams, fostering a positive and efficient on-site culture.
- Work with Lead Regional Producer on city-specific permitting, compliance, and documentation requirements, including onsite visits to the permitting office if necessary.
- Ensure wayfinding, signage, and guest-facing operational elements are accurate, clear, and efficiently positioned to support smooth audience movement.

- Coordinate onsite inspections with fire marshals, electricians, and other local officials.
- Ensure the safe execution of all activities through adherence to company safety guidelines and local regulations.
- Troubleshoot issues in real time, making informed decisions to maintain show quality and continuity.
Operational Excellence & Vendor Management
- Be the primary liaison for the venue, contractors, and internal stakeholders across departments.
- Manage equipment inventories, maintenance plans, and weatherization needs across all markets.
- Oversee transportation logistics, including shipping, trucking, and packing standards throughout the tour.
Tour Logistics & Reporting
- Coordinate travel, lodging, and daily workflows for yourself.
With Lead Regional Producer
- With collaboration of lead producers, track expenses, manage budgets, and escalate any variances to stakeholders.
- Produce post-city evaluations to refine processes and elevate future performance.
- Serve as the consistent bridge between on-site execution and the Fever office support teams.
What You Bring
- 5+ years in touring production, technical direction, live events, or similar, outdoor event experience preferred.
- Professional fluency in English. Knowledge of other European languages is a significant asset.
- Proven ability to lead teams in dynamic environments, manage multiple priorities, and operate under tight timelines.
- Strong understanding of event production fundamentals, including lighting, power, sound, rigging, safety, and onsite operations.
- Experience interpreting technical drawings and translating them into actionable onsite plans.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to manage relationships with clarity and professionalism.
- Comfortable traveling full-time late April-May and late July-September, and working in an outdoor environment.
- Calm under pressure, proactive, and highly organized, with the ability to anticipate challenges.
- Valid driver’s license; experience driving forklifts, vans or small trucks is a plus.
